Directions to applicants Applications must be submitted on form Z.83, obtainable

from any Public Service Department and must be accompanied by certified copies

of qualifications, driver’s license, identity document and a C.V. (Separate

application for every vacancy). Applicants are requested to complete the Z83 form

properly and in full. Qualification certificates must not be copies of certified copies.

Applications received after the closing date and those that do not comply with

these instructions will not be considered. The onus is on the applicants to ensure

that their applications are posted or hand delivered timeously. Candidates who

possess foreign qualifications and/or short courses certificates must take it upon

themselves to have their qualifications evaluated by the South African

Qualifications Authority (SAQA), and must please attach proof of the level of their

qualifications after evaluation on all applications. No e-mailed or faxed applications

will be considered. Applicants are respectfully informed that if no notification of

appointment is received within 4 months of the closing date, they must accept that

their application was unsuccessful.

A completed Apprenticeship and passed Trade Test in terms of the Provisions of

Section 13(2) (h) of the Manpower Training Act of 1981, as amended or a

Certificate issued under the Provision of the Repealed Section 27 of the same Act.

Knowledge of the Occupational Health and Safety Act, 1993 (Act No. 85 of 1993)

(OHS Act).
